Minetti Sports Cars is an Australian company which designs and constructs racing cars. Located on the Sunshine Coast QLD, Minetti started with the ZZ/I design, utilised for small engine capacity prototype sports car racing. Since then Minetti have followed up with the SS-V1 design. Both cars have utilised motorcycle sourced engines, mostly Suzuki Hayabusa,[1] for powerplants to run in the Supersports category. The earlier ZZ/I design has won championships at state level in both New South Wales and Queensland while the later SS-V1 has had class wins in the QLD Sportscar Championship and also took out the 2008 National Supersprint Championship.[2]
